Worried about failing

Hi. First year studying computer science.
I will try my best to summarise everything. Through a mixture of bad habits that have gotten really out of control here, being extremely ignorant to my academic studies and emotional and financial instability, since I got here I managed to get an extremely low attendance rate. I don't think my overall is above 30%. I have some courses that I've also never been to. In my exams in January I got above 80% to each besides one course(Communication Systems) in wich I took 20 and also haven't been attending the labs.
The second term is also over as well and I also managed to not show up to my Maths module not even once, this also being the case for Systems Architecture. If only speaking about grades I am confident that I can well pass everything besides 1 module (or 2 I don't know if they count as 1) but as I said my attendance is very poor and already been flagged twice.

I don't want to make more excuses for myself and run away from my problems. I know that what I did is very ignorant and I really have to become more responsible.
3:40 AM right now and I'm writing this message. Yup, not going to sleep tonight (out of context, I know). Do you think that I will fail my year? Will I be withdrawn from my studies? Is the volume of work here "re-sit-able"? Is it too late? How hard is it to change Courses? (eg. Business Computing). So many questions..



TL;DR - I am an irresponsible person trying to make things right. If I fail 1 module with the others being over 80 and have my attendance very poor(under 30) will I fail my year? Can I move to another course such as Business Computing?

Thank you in advance.
First, off it doesn't sound like you're failing and it sounds like you're confident of doing well in the exams. Has the uni contacted you about your attendance being an issue for progression to the next year? If not then it's not an issue. I would make an appointment with your personal tutor ASAP and explain what's going on and why and what you plan to do about it. Work hard for these exams and find out what the process is for resitting the one you didn't do well in last term and pull your socks up for next year.
